"Will someone explain to me why it's called a sequencer? What does it
sequence?"
A synthesizer is a device that creates sounds (both imitative and abstract.) A
sequencer is a device for recording and replaying MIDI data (usually in
multi-track format) allowing compositions to be built up a part at a time.
